Basic Grey Challenge #10 ~ Glitter


DARK SNOWFLAKE

For the Basic Grey Challenge blog. Probably the simplest card I have ever made! Uses Ambrosia paper. Would be a great option for mass-producing a lot of cards, as it was very quick.

Cut paper to size, ink the edges, and stick down. Stamp two large snowflakes in Versafine Onyx black ink. Use a small paintbrush to paint Craft Planet silver glitter glue over the snowflakes.
